Exciton dynamics of C(60)-based single-photon emitters explored by Hanbury Brown–Twiss scanning tunnelling microscopy
Exciton creation and annihilation by charges are crucial processes for technologies relying on charge-exciton-photon conversion. Improvement of organic light sources or dye-sensitized solar cells requires methods to address exciton dynamics at the molecular scale. Near-field techniques have been ins...
